A deep red beer with a beutiful beige head. The aroma is sweet with notes of yeast, corriander, and plums. The flavor is sweet malty with notes of corriander and plums giving way to a dry hoppy end. The body is thin - especially considering the 8% ABV.

(Bottle 33 cl) Dark amber with a full and frothy head. Very dry, almost ashy flavours - far from the malty sweetness one would expect in a Dubbel. An odd sour finish almost reminiscent of Rodenbach although somehow not as quenching. An odd bird indeed. 301297

33 cL bottle, as Ambiorix Bruin Bier. Pours clear and golden brown with a huge, slowly collapsing and tan head. Mild roasted and medium dry malt aroma. Mild sweet caramel malt flavoured, subdued yeast presence. Nice crisp caramel malt flavoured into the finish.

Bottle. Light unclear medium brown color with a average to large, frothy / creamy, good lacing, mostly lasting, beige head. Aroma is moderate malty, caramel / roasted,nutty, moderate yeasty, light brown sugar. Flavor is moderate to light heavy sweet and light to moderate bitter with a average to long duration. (Nut bitternes). Body is medium, texture is oily, carbonation is soft. (151007)
